LG Optimus Vu to make global launch next month and should hit the States sometime this quarter
0. phoneArena posted on 19 Aug 2012, 23:52
The LG Optimus Vu will be making its global launch next month according to LG; the 5 incher had been available in Korea and Japan and now will be making its way to the Middle East, Africa, Europe, Asia and Latin America next month with a U.S. release expected later this quarter...
